§ 4. Recording with the recorders. Within 30 days after the publication of said notice as provided by the preceding section in this act as to all such corporations excepting religious corporations, the certificate of the Secretary of State, as required by Clause 6 of Section 2 of this act, to which shall be attached the certificate of the said publication of notice, shall be recorded in the office of the recorder of each county in which the principal place of business of each of the corporations so merged or consolidated is located.
